Boston Red Sox (30-34, fourth in the AL East) vs. New York Yankees (38-23, first in the AL East)

New York; Friday, 7:05 p.m. EDT

PITCHING PROBABLES: Red Sox: Walker Buehler (4-3, 4.44 ERA, 1.31 WHIP, 42 strikeouts); Yankees: Will Warren (3-3, 5.19 ERA, 1.42 WHIP, 69 strikeouts)

BETMGM SPORTSBOOK LINE: Yankees -175, Red Sox +146; over/under is 9 runs

BOTTOM LINE: The New York Yankees begin a three-game series at home against the Boston Red Sox on Friday.

New York has a 20-10 record at home and a 38-23 record overall. The Yankees are 22-5 in games when they scored at least five runs.

Boston has a 13-18 record on the road and a 30-34 record overall. The Red Sox are 6-17 in games decided by one run.

The matchup Friday is the first meeting of the season between the two clubs.

TOP PERFORMERS: Paul Goldschmidt has 13 doubles, a triple, six home runs and 28 RBIs while hitting .323 for the Yankees. Aaron Judge is 12 for 32 with three doubles and three home runs over the last 10 games.

Jarren Duran has 17 doubles, six triples, four home runs and 35 RBIs while hitting .274 for the Red Sox. Ceddanne Rafaela is 14 for 41 with two doubles and four home runs over the past 10 games.

LAST 10 GAMES: Yankees: 7-3, .229 batting average, 4.30 ERA, outscored by seven runs

Red Sox: 3-7, .251 batting average, 3.93 ERA, outscored by nine runs

INJURIES: Yankees: Luke Weaver: 15-Day IL (hamstring), Oswaldo Cabrera: 10-Day IL (ankle), Giancarlo Stanton: 60-Day IL (elbow), Marcus Stroman: 15-Day IL (knee), JT Brubaker: 60-Day IL (ribs), Jake Cousins: 60-Day IL (elbow), Gerrit Cole: 60-Day IL (elbow), Luis Gil: 60-Day IL (back)

Red Sox: Nick Burdi: 15-Day IL (knee), Justin Slaten: 15-Day IL (shoulder), Liam Hendriks: 15-Day IL (hip), Alex Bregman: 10-Day IL (quadricep), Triston Casas: 60-Day IL (knee), Masataka Yoshida: 60-Day IL (shoulder), Kutter Crawford: 60-Day IL (knee), Tanner Houck: 15-Day IL (flexor), Chris Murphy: 60-Day IL (elbow), Patrick Sandoval: 60-Day IL (elbow)
